Actually i'm not in a 4G area and this affected me also. Woke up to seeing only 1x. eHRPD is closely linked to 4G in terms of it being up or down. So when 4G goes down, so does 3g for those connected to eHRPD and not Rev.A. So it would have made sense to send it out to all thunderbolt owners regarding this outage, and all fugure phones that are LTE/eHRPD enabled.

I woke up, saw 1x, and figured it was because of an outage again on 4g/eHRPD and forced my phone down to Rev.A to get 3g back until it's fixed.
